We are developing a new improved dynamic CRM, we are seeking a Team Lead / Senior .NET Software Developer to oversee the technical development of their Software Team.
You will also provide technical leadership and mentor Engineers within the team. You will develop software systems from initial requirements, through design, implementation and test.
As a Team Lead / Senior .NET Software Developer, you will ideally have experience across the following areas:
1. 7+ years of software development experience using C# .Net with strong previous experience in development using
ASP.Net and C#, WEB API, WCF services, Restful Services, LINQ, Entity Framework, Bootstrap, NuGet Packages
2. Strong experience in Angular JS, Jquery, Ajax, JSON, LINQ, Web API, WCF.
3. Strong previous experience of working with SQL databases.
4. Familiar with Visual Studio, SVN, online/offline development environment.
5. Appreciation of good software architecture, Computer Science fundamentals and Data Structures
6. Good knowledge of database design and usage.
Responsibilities
1. Work on daily basis as a bridge between the management and engineering team for task and deadline management and delivering on project milestones. Will take responsibility and accountability to take the application development forward in required time-to-market.
2. Work with a team of back-end programmers and a front-end programmer/designer.
3. Mentor and coach team in their programming/coding approach, code reviews, code optimisation, quality enhancement checks,
4. Handle assigned complex tasks independently at fast-pace and with high quality, both design and development using Agile development methodology.
5. Analyse and understand end product requirements and specs in terms of functionality, usability, and reliability and implement it as-is.
6. Experience with multiple levels of software architecture, including user interface, business logic, data access, database, security, and analytics.
7. Test and review code for technical accuracy, performance, standards, and functional compliance to the design.
8. Delivering quality products based on enhanced ‘customer experience’ and ‘differentiation’
9. Participate in the investigation and resolution of software defects, bug triage and quality processes.
10. Fulfil administrative and status reporting requirements and other tasks as assigned by the management.
Our offices are based in London, we are either looking for a full time person, or over set days/hours per month.
